Cost Range - Replacing cedar shingles typically costs between $7,000 and $15,000 for a standard-sized roof. Factors such as roof size and shingle quality can influence the overall price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Material Expenses - Cedar shingles themselves usually range from $4 to $8 per square foot. Higher-quality or custom shingles may increase material costs, impacting the total replacement expense. Contractors can help determine the best options for budget and durability.
Labor Costs - Labor for cedar shingle replacement generally accounts for about 50% to 70% of the total project cost. Rates vary depending on the complexity of the roof and local market conditions in Twin Lakes, WI. Experienced service providers can offer cost estimates tailored to each project.
Additional Fees - Costs for removing old shingles, disposal, and any necessary roof repairs can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. These additional expenses depend on the condition of the existing roof and the scope of work required. Local contractors can clarify potential extra costs during consultations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? The replacement frequency depends on factors like age, exposure, and maintenance, but typically shingles may need replacement every 20-30 years. A local professional can assess the condition of existing shingles to determine if replacement is necessary.
What signs indicate cedar shingles need replacement? Signs include extensive cracking, warping, mold, or significant loss of shingles. If shingles are visibly damaged or deteriorated, replacement services may be recommended by a local contractor.
Can c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age can sometimes be repaired, but extensive deterioration often requires complete replacement. A local expert can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is the better option.
What is involved in cedar shingle replacement? Replacement involves removing damaged shingles and installing new ones to match existing siding. Experienced local service providers can ensure proper installation for durability and appearance.
How long does cedar shingle repl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the area and extent of damage, but a local contractor can provide an estimated timeline after assessment. Generally, replacements can be completed within a few days.
